At Dr Sknn, we utilise the Lynton Lumina, a sophisticated Intense Pulsed Light System (IPL) also used by the NHS and private hospitals all over the UK to treat Thread Veins securely and efficiently on skin types I-IV. By emitting light in particular wavelength ranges, Dr Sknn targets absorption peaks in haemoglobin and oxy-haemoglobin, permitting us to treat Thread Veins of varying sizes and depths while causing minimal harm to the surrounding skin. After treatment, the damaged vessels are reabsorbed by the body and little or no trace of the initial lesion remains.

At Dr Sknn, intense pulsed light (IPL) is used to make the most of light energy. This light is consumed by the blood vessels, heating them to the point of either spasm or complete collapse, thus forming a seal. In the following weeks, the damaged vessels are broken down and the body absorbs them, leaving no evidence of the original lesion.

At Dr Sknn, a medical history, physical examination and photographs will be taken during the consultation, in which any worries, expectations, results or queries can be openly discussed. In advance of the treatment, potential post-treatment counsel and any associated risks of the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) procedure will be gone through, to make sure full comprehension is attained and a consent form is duly signed. Moreover, if it's a previously untouched area, a slight patch test will be executed to guarantee suitability.
